Output 27eb5bb5e52849c1283933240ba0a17b91f137f980e6f8f02a0de16ce1b64801:7

value
1029306
script pubkey
OP_0 OP_PUSHBYTES_20 e465d63ae93c8f2c9bb5199c326b98a4f13634f5
address
bc1qu3javwhf8j8jexa4rxwry6uc5ncnvd84humgrp
transaction
27eb5bb5e52849c1283933240ba0a17b91f137f980e6f8f02a0de16ce1b64801
confirmations
225219
spent
true